I had this problem too. No matter how many water changes I did it came back! It was getting me mad! It was always a little cloudy because mine was a newly set up tank but it got green and impossible too see my fish! But I did an 80% water change way larger then the others and had no lights for 3 days and changed all the media and then a few days after crystal clear!
